详解Bootstrap使用基础教程
Bootstrap是用于快速开发Web应用程序和网站的前端框架,Bootstrap基于HTML、CSS、JavaScript而建成,那么让爱站技术频道小编来给大家说说详解Bootstrap使用基础教程吧。
一:Bootstrap简介
Boostrap是一个非常受欢迎的前端开发框架,该框架极大的提高前端团队的开发效率。 Bootstrap对常见的CSS布局组件和JavaScript插件进行了完整的封装,使开发人员可以轻松使用。 使用Bootstrap可以快速制作精美的响应式页面,并且兼容移动端。
二:Bootstrap特性
提供一套完整的CSS插件 丰富的预定义样式表 一组基于jQuery的JS插件表 灵活的响应式删格系统 移动先行 基于Less和Sass开发。
三:使用Bootstrap
1. 第一步:
到http://www.bootcss.com/下载最新的bootstrap。 解压后有三个文件夹,分别放置css,js和字体。 CSS和JavaScript文件分别有一个压缩版,可以根据需要选择一个版本。开发时使用未压缩版,在发布时使用压缩版本。
2.固定模板代码展示
你好,世界!
3.基本用法:
3.1整体框架-12栅格系统
bootstrap的核心是12栅格系统。 12栅格系统就是把网页的内容区域按照宽度平分为12份,网页开发人员可以自由按份组合,方便网页的布局,使排版看起来整齐规范。
bootstarp提供了一个名为container的样式容器 .container是一个自动居中,高度自适应的样式。用.container作为网页内容最外层的div样式,可以轻松的实现12栅格的网页布局。 并且,这种12栅格系统是根据屏幕大小自适应的,.container会自动根据屏幕大小调整总宽度和栅格的平均宽度。
col-lg-n 最大列宽95px 在>=1200px像素的情况下将.container12等分 每份宽度95px 其余情况宽度为100%
col-md-n 最大宽度78px; 在>=992px像素的情况下将.container12等分 其余情况100%
col-sm-n 最大列宽60px 在>=768px像素的情况下将.container12等分 其余情况100%
col-xs-n 列宽根据视口大小12等分 在任何尺寸的屏幕下都将.container 12等分
3.2基础样式
(1)Bootstrap的h1-h6样式取消了加粗,重新定义了上下外边距 h1-h3 margin-top:20px; margin-bottom-10px; H3-h6 margin-top:10px; margin-bottom-10px;
(2)定义了4个对齐方式的样式,分别是.text-left, .text-center, .text-right,.text-justify .text-justify 英文字母的两端对齐
(3)Bootstrap提供了五种默认的颜色样式,-primary 重点蓝, -success成功绿,-info信息蓝 -warning 警告橙,-danger危险红
3.3btn组件+btn-group
alert组件
一般的组件都有四种尺寸,超小xs, 小型sm, 普通, 大型lg 使用方法是 组件名-尺寸 同一组件不同类型的按钮可以结合使用
3.4table表格样式:
给table元素添加一个div父元素,给这个div添加class=”table-responsive” 创建相应式表格,当视口像素小于768px时候,会出现水平滚动条
1 | 1 | 1 |
2 | 2 | 2 |
3 | 3 | 3 |
3.5Badge徽章
3.6导航条
(1)胶囊式导航条
(2)标签式导航条
- 公司新闻
- 公司新闻
- 公司新闻
- 行业新闻
- 行业新闻
- 行业新闻
- 通知公告
- 通知公告
- 通知公告
3.7 input-group
3.8轮播
3.9面板panel-group
3.10媒体查询
下一篇:JS注册页面的简单实例